THE FLORAL DRESS FILTER
Floral can go wrong fast.
Most of it feels:
- too bright
- too structured
- too literal
The ones that work tend to feel slightly off in the right way:
- muted or washed tones
- prints that don’t feel perfectly placed
- fabric that moves instead of holds
If it feels like something you just threw on and it happened to work… then that’s the one.
THE SILHOUETTES THAT ACTUALLY WORK
Instead of forcing shape, the right dresses:
- skim instead of sculpt
- move instead of hold
- sit slightly away from the body
Bias cuts, soft A-lines, relaxed midis.
Nothing overly tailored. Nothing that needs adjusting.
If you have to fix it while wearing it, it’s already wrong.
